Petzl offer some headlamps with a USB rechargeable lithium battery pack. I have the Tikka RXP which is very bright, but its multi mode with a low setting and a red LED for night vision. It also claims you can reprogram the light settings via USB, but I havent tried that

Being USB rechargeable you can charge it from a standard micro-USB charger, such as a cellphone charger, or from a PC USB port. The battery pack is removable, so you can get a spare and also a battery carrier that takes 3xAAA if you wanted backup

I just grabbed a Nitecore MH2A off the exchange. It's pretty sweet. USB rechargeable with the included battery, but can also run on two AA batteries (at a lower lumen brightness of course), and puts out a pretty respectable 600 lumens on the included rechargeable battery. It's definitely too long for pocket carry, but is a great car flashlight or for in a backpack. The longer light feels good in the hand as well and really makes you feel like you're holding a flashlight without being huge like a Maglite.

Also, just FYI, here are the runtimes:

High: 500 lumens for 1.5 minutes, then a slow step down to 300 lumens for 90 minutes
Medium: 80 lumens for 6 hours
Low: 8 lumens for 40 hours
Moonlight: .5 lumens for 25 days

That's all with a cr123 battery. It'll take a rcr123 too but the runtimes are considerably less.
